Abstract

Systems and methods including a database storing the identifiers of cells representing residential parcels of real estate properties. Mobile devices determine the coordinates of their locations during a period of time using a location determination system, such as a global positioning system. The coordinates are converted to cell identifiers to look up corresponding residential parcels that have been visited by the mobile devices. A server generates a visitation data set for each residential parcel visited by each mobile device, including different types of frequencies of the mobile device visiting the residential parcel (e.g., night, weekend). A server filters the residential parcels based on visitation frequencies to identify home candidates and then further filters the home candidates based on the count of mobile devices having the home candidates. A home parcel, and thus its address, is identified from the filtered home candidate(s) for each mobile device.

Claims (71)

1. A computing device, comprising:

at least one microprocessor; and

memory storing instructions configured to instruct the at least one microprocessor to:

store location data of a mobile device, the location data specifying, for each respective time instance of a plurality of time instances in a period of time, a respective location of the mobile device determined by a position determination unit of the mobile device; and

identify a location of a home of a user of the mobile device, by:

identifying, for the respective location of the mobile device at the respective time instance, a respective region that has a predefined boundary and contains the respective location, wherein locations specified in the location data are contained within a plurality of regions containing the locations;

determining, for the respective location of the mobile device at the respective time instance, a visitation type, wherein the locations specified in the location data have a plurality of different visitation types;

identifying, from the plurality of regions visited by the respective mobile device, a plurality of region candidates for the home of the user of the mobile device;

computing, for each of the region candidates, a plurality of visitation frequencies corresponding to the plurality of different visitation types respectively;

computing, for each of the region candidates, a score based at least in part on the plurality of visitation frequencies, wherein the plurality of region candidates have a plurality of scores respectively; and

selecting, from the plurality of region candidates based on the plurality of scores, a home region as the home of the user.

2. The computing device of claim 1 , wherein the identifying of the respective region that contains the respective location includes:

storing a set of cell identifiers of a hierarchical grid system having grid lines aligned with numbers of digits of precision in longitudinal and latitudinal coordinates on the earth, including store each respective cell identifier of the set of cell identifiers in association with a set of region identifiers identifying one or more regions that are at least partially in a cell identified by the respective cell identifier;

converting to a cell identifier the respective location of the mobile device;

searching in the set of cell identifiers for a match of the cell identifier converted from the respective location of the mobile device;

retrieving a region identifier pre-associated with the matched cell identifier; and

identifying the respective region based on the retrieved region identifier.

3. The computing device of claim 1 , wherein the predefined boundary is a parcel boundary of land in residential areas.

4. The computing device of claim 3 , wherein the plurality of visitation types include:

visitations on different days;

visitations on different days in night hours; and

visitations on different days in weekends.

5. The computing device of claim 4 , further comprising:

determining, by the computing device, a count of different mobile devices having location in each of the regions during the period of time;

wherein the selecting of the home region is further based on the count of different mobile devices having location instances in each of the regions.

6. The computing device of claim 5 , wherein the selecting of the home region includes:

identifying a first subset of the region candidates, wherein each region candidate in the first subset has a count of different mobile devices less than a first threshold; and

selecting the home region from the first subset based on the scores.
